5. Do math

Lomonosov believed that mathematics puts the mind in order. And indeed it is. One way to develop intelligence is to make friends with the world of numbers, graphs and formulas. If you want to try this method, the book Beauty Squared will help you, where the most complex concepts are described simply and in a fun way. A small excerpt from there:

“In 1611, the astronomer Johannes Kepler decided to find himself a wife. The process did not start well: he rejected the first three candidates. Kepler would have married a fourth if he had not seen a fifth, who seemed "modest, thrifty, and capable of loving adopted children." But the scientist behaved so indecisively that he met with several more women who did not interest him. Then he nevertheless married the fifth candidate.

According to the mathematical theory of "optimal stopping", in order to make a choice, it is necessary to consider and reject 36.8 percent of the possible options. And then stop at the first one, which will be better than all those rejected.

Kepler had 11 dates. But he could meet with four women and then propose to the first of the remaining candidates, whom he liked more than those he had already seen. In other words, he would immediately pick the fifth woman and save himself six bad dates. The theory of “optimal stopping” is also applicable in other areas: medicine, energy, zoology, economics, etc.”

6. Learn to play a musical instrument

Psychologist and author of We Are Music, Victoria Williamson, says the Mozart effect is just a myth. Listening to classical music will not increase your IQ. But if you make music yourself, you will help your brain work better. This is confirmed by the following experiment:

“A number of extensive analyzes of the relationship between music lessons and IQ in children have been conducted by Glenn Schellenberg. In 2004, he randomly assigned 144 six-year-olds from Toronto to four groups: the first had keyboard lessons, the second had singing lessons, the third had acting lessons, and the fourth was a control group with no extra lessons. To be fair, after the study, the children in the control group were offered the same activities as the rest.

The training lasted 36 weeks in a dedicated school. All children took IQ tests during summer holidays before these sessions began, and also at the end of the study. Criteria of comparable age and socioeconomic status were used.

After one year, the vast majority of the children performed better on the IQ test, which is logical since they are a year older. However, in the two music groups, the increase in IQ was greater than in the acting and control groups.”

8. Learn to think outside the box

Creativity will help find a solution even in a situation that seems hopeless to most. book author"Rice Storm"I am sure that anyone can train creativity. To get started, try applying the Leonardo da Vinci method:

“Leonardo da Vinci’s way of generating ideas was this: he closed his eyes, completely relaxed and dotted a sheet of paper with arbitrary lines and scribbles. Then he opened his eyes and looked for images and nuances, objects and phenomena in the painted. Many of his inventions were born from such sketches.

Here is a plan of action on how you can use the Leonardo da Vinci method in your work:

Write the problem down on a piece of paper and reflect on it for a few minutes.

Relax. Give your intuition the opportunity to create images that reflect the current situation. You don't need to know what the drawing will look like before you draw it.

Give shape to your challenge by delineating its boundaries. They can be of any size and take shape as you wish.

Practice drawing unconsciously. Let the lines and scribbles dictate how you draw and position them.

If the result does not satisfy you, take another sheet of paper and make another drawing, and then another - as many as you need.

Explore your drawing. Write down the first word that comes to mind for each image, squiggle, line, or structure.

Tie all the words together by writing a short note. Now see how the writing relates to your task. Have new ideas emerged?

Be attentive to the questions that arise in your mind. For example: “What is this?”, “Where did it come from?” If you feel the need to find answers to specific questions, then you are on the right path leading to a solution to the problem.

11. Get enough sleep!

The ability to learn depends on the quality of your sleep. A curious fact from the book "The Brain in a Dream":

“Scientists have found that different stages of sleep are meant for different types of learning. For example, non-REM sleep is important for mastering actual memory tasks, such as memorizing dates for a history exam. But dream-filled REM sleep is necessary for mastering what is associated with procedural memory - with how something is done, including with the development of new behavioral strategies.

Psychology professor Carlisle Smith says: “For a month we sawed out blocks from which we built a maze for mice, and then recorded their brain activity around the clock for ten days. Those mice that showed greater intelligence in running through the maze also showed greater brain activity during REM sleep. I myself never doubted that sleep and learning are related, but now enough data has accumulated that others are interested in this issue. ”

12. Don't neglect exercise

Sport has a positive effect on our intellectual abilities. Here is what evolutionary biologist John Medina has to say in his book The Rules of the Brain:

“All sorts of tests have shown that physical activity throughout life contributes to a striking improvement in cognitive processes, in contrast to a sedentary lifestyle. The exercisers outperformed the lazy and couch potato in terms of long-term memory, logic, attention, problem-solving ability, and even so-called fluid intelligence.”

Multiple intelligence theory

In 1983, scientist Howard Gardner described the theory of seven models of intelligence in his book. Working in this area, a few years later he added another model. This theory has gained incredible popularity. The reason for this is the following fact. People have learned that the development of brain activity occurs in different areas, depending on individual characteristics individual.

The work of the scientist proved that each person has a high intelligence in different areas. All 8 models are combined, creating a common background for intellectual development.

The basis for this development is genetic characteristics and life experience.

  1. Language.
  2. Logico-mathematical.
  3. Musical.
  4. Body-kinetic.
  5. Interpersonal.
  6. Intrapersonal.
  7. Spatial.
  8. Naturalistic.

Many attempts have been made to create a test for the level of development of a certain intelligence. These tests were intended to enable a person to determine what kind of intelligence he can develop, and which one prevails. But the scientist came to the conclusion that this is almost unrealistic. This is due to the fact that the questions in the tests would provide information about the interests and preferences of people.

Tasks and puzzles for self-development

Examples of tasks for the development of intelligence:

  1. Alexander Sergeevich decided to open his own business in the field of sales. His goal was to open a pet shop. Initially, he sold rare cats because they were in stock. Alexander Sergeevich purchased large cages for cats. When he let one cat into each cage, one cat was missing a house. And if two cats were placed in each cage, one cage remained empty. How many cages did Alexander Sergeevich buy, and how many cats did he initially have?
    Answer: Alexander Sergeevich had 4 cats and bought 3 cages.
  2. Two packs of wolves lived in the same forest. One pack always told the truth, the other pack always lied. One day a man got lost in the forest and he met a wolf. When the man found out that the wolf was from a pack of truthful animals, he asked to be shown the way out of the forest. Along the way, they met another wolf. The man asked the first wolf to go to find out which pack the second wolf belongs to: liars or truthful ones. Upon returning, the wolf said that the second animal belonged to a pack of truthful wolves. Which pack did the accompanying wolf belong to?
    Answer: In the forest, any wolf from any pack could say that he was one of the truthful pack. That is why the wolf said the only possible answer. Therefore, he was from the truthful flock.

Way to develop intelligence # 9: Physical activity

Physical activity, such as lifting weights, running, pulling up or push-ups, of course, does not directly affect intelligence. However, they have a very indirect effect. The fact is that during physical exertion, the so-called neurotropic factor of the brain is produced. This is a protein that is responsible for the development of neurons, the very cells that are key in our brain.

So it turns out: the load on the muscles contributes to the development of intelligence. However, it should be noted that since this method is indirect, it is ineffective by itself, but it can significantly increase the efficiency of all other methods.

2. Make sure you get enough sleep

Numerous studies have shown that sleep deprivation reduces concentration, short-term and long-term memory, problem solving speed, visual and hearing acuity, and slows reaction times. Especially for maintaining good mental health, the right combination of deep and REM sleep is important. Here again, physical exercises from Lifehacker will help you.
